> When the site is built with Maven 2, JDK Rev remains empty, when Maven 3
> builds the site, everything is fine.
> I have configured source and target to 1.6 explicitly in my parent pom.
> After a code review, I have discovered that how the compiler plugin config is
> retrieved it does not work for Maven 2 but for Maven 3 only. Luckily the
> JavaDoc plugin requires the same information and has working code
> (AbstractJavadocMojo#getPluginParameter). I have adapted the source code and
> patched the MPIR plugin. Now I am able to display JDK Rev with both Maven
> versions.
> Patch has been applied against tags/2.6
> This is somewhat related to MJAVADOC-310 and MPIR-263
